This week, Joshua Holland kicks off the show with a look at what the #DNCLeaks do and don't tell us about the relationship between senior party officials and the Sanders campaign.
Then we'll be joined by two Salon columnists to take a look back at the two major parties' political conventions. They offered dramatically different presentations of the world around us.
First, we'll speak to Amanda Marcotte about what it was like in the belly of the beast -- at the GOP convention in Cleveland. Amanda also caught some of the fireworks in Philadelphia.
Then we'll talk about the Democrats' remarkably inclusive convention in Philadelphia, which culminated in the first woman being nominated to top a major party ticket.

Karoli Kuns Read 10,000 Clinton Emails

Crooks and Liars managing editor Karoli Kuns was a self-proclaimed "Clinton hater." She waded through thousands of Hillary Clinton's emails digging for dirt, but she came away from the exercise with a very different view of the Democratic nominee.
In this clip, Kuns speaks with Politics and Reality Radio host Joshua Holland about what she gleaned from a deep dive into the emails that have stirred so much controversy.

This week, we start with a commentary about the mass shooting of police officers at a peaceful Black Lives Matter protest in Dallas.
Then we're joined by Robert Gangi, executive director of the Police Reform Organizing Project (PROP), to discuss the two unjustified police shootings of black men that apparently pushed the Dallas shooter over the edge.
We also talk to Karoli Kuns, managing editor of Crooks and Liars, about FBI Director James Comey's recommendation that Hillary Clinton not face charges for Emailghazi, and the backlash it set off on the right.
Finally, we welcome Cristina Lopez, a researcher and reporter at Media Matters, to talk about the lawsuit filed by Gretchen Carlson this week alleging that Fox News boss Roger Ailes sexually harrassed her in the grossest possible way.
